HD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2013 in Review

1,322 of the 3,447 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Home Depot (HD) for Q4 2013, worth a combined $83.8B — up 7.1% from $78.3B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 160 funds opened new HD positions and 54 closed out — a net gain of 106 holders — while 437 added to existing stakes and 576 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Barclays, adding an estimated $497M. The largest seller was Capital World Investors, cutting an estimated $514M.
